Thinking of moving to Canton?

Here’s what the numbers say about housing costs in Canton. A typical home runs about $161,000, which is 44% more affordable than the national median and 29% more affordable than the Ohio average. At roughly $108 per square foot, a median budget here buys you around 1,490 sq ft of home.

Prices swing a lot by neighborhood: across Canton’s 11 ZIP codes, the most affordable is 44704 (~$81,000) and the priciest is 44718 (~$378,000) — roughly a 4.7× difference. If you’re relocating, that spread is where the real budgeting happens, so it pays to target ZIP by ZIP rather than the citywide average.

Home values by ZIP code in Canton, OH

Typical value and price per square foot for each Canton ZIP code we have data for:

ZIP codeTypical value$ / sq ft
44718$378,000$158
44721$303,000$152
44708$203,000$141
44709$192,000$126
44706$163,000$108
44714$161,000$111
44710$127,000$103
44707$115,000$107
44705$105,000$96
44703$102,000$94
44704$81,000$77
